Google Cuts Chrome Release Cycle to Every 2 Weeks Amid Intense Competition
Google is accelerating Chrome’s release schedule amid rising browser competition. The company will produce updates every two weeks, doubling its release cadence, starting with Version 153 of the browser, which launches on September 8.
Why the Faster Release Cycle?
Google says the web platform evolves quickly, making it necessary for developers and everyday users to receive updates sooner. Despite the faster cadence, the brand claims that more frequent improvements will improve browser stability.
Meanwhile, Google’s Dev and Canary channels will maintain their current update timelines, as will the “Extended Stable” branch for enterprise users. A Google spokesperson told TechCrunch that the increased release cadence isn’t AI-related, however, the timing suggests otherwise.
Impact of AI-Powered Browsers
AI companies like OpenAI and Perplexity recently launched their own AI-powered browsers, while Microsoft continues to add Copilot AI features to Edge. Google hasn’t boosted its Chrome updates since 2021; now, it’s cutting the browser’s between-release time in half again.
